Transaction 81a59d1152d075052cf3dcb2278f4e29fe9c637127a33b48b146f749e3d6dea2
1 Input
1 Output
-
81a59d1152d075052cf3dcb2278f4e29fe9c637127a33b48b146f749e3d6dea2:0
- value
- 2513659
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a3e164efa1a094f0ad5a39a25898380b4a97ef16 OP_EQUAL
- address
- 3GdY5UsUp3wrwpsz7LT59VGNGSS5KgSwjy